About PEG-12 Methyl Ether Lauroxy PEG-5 Amidopropyl Dimethicone
PEG-12 Methyl Ether Lauroxy PEG-5 Amidopropyl Dimethicone is a silicone polymer.[1] The number 12 in the name indicates the average number of added ethylene oxide units; with the same base structure, changing this number can affect water miscibility and the viscosity and spreadability of the formula. In cosmetics, it is used to reduce tangling and rough feel in hair, leaving it smooth and neatly conditioned.[2]
